New Rules FIRST
DFA is located at the 4th floor Pacific Mall in Mandaue City. If you are not from Mandaue City like me, take a taxi getting there.
Issuance of Priority Numbers (If you are not a minor, pwd or a senior citizen, you must get priority number)
9:00 pm to 6:00 am the following day. Pacific Mall will issue a priority number. Present valid ID and old passport if renewal and NSO birth certificate at the guard near the entrance. He will give you an application form to fill up.
6:01-:6:30 am Setting the"Pila" based on Pacific Mall Priority Numbers
6:31 am onwards DFA will release priority numbers. The guard will call out your number and return your valid ID so listen carefully.Surrender the Pacific Mall priority number, and submit valid ID and application form. The priority numbers issued from DFA is not necessarily the same as the Pacific Mall numbers so be alert when the guard calls your number.

The process:
1. The Front Desk: Accepts your priority number and gives you back the application form and valid ID. He instructs you to have the ID xeroxed. There's a copier inside the office but the line is long so photocopy everything to save time.
2. Acceptance of application form with documents. Theres a sit-down pila inside so ask who is the last person. I apologize to those people in line, I accidently inserted in the line while asking the guy if they gave out numbers. The guy told me to sit down so I did. Little did I know that i just inserted in the pila. Fortunately I did not hear violent reactions.
For renewal of passport: Application form, Old passport with xerox (first data page and last page), valid ID with xerox, NSO birth certificate (original and xerox)
For new passport, please visit DFA Site for the list of requirements coz there's more documents that are required.
The person in charge will staple everything and return it to you for the next step.
3. Payment- Submit your papers at Window 2 then wait for your name to be called. I paid P950 for regular processing . Its better to have P50 ready or the exact amount. The process: Submit your papers, and pose for the camera. Remember, no earrings and necklace so leave your jewels at home. Also no bangs and ears should be visible, so hair back. I looked so ugly & haggard in my passport photo, it looks more like a prison photo than a passport photo. Even if its a renewal, they are still encoding my info. so watch the screen as they encode your name and other info. Double check, FIRST NAME, LAST NAME, MIDDLE NAME for spelling. Also DATE of BIRTH and Place of Birth. They will print the data for you to sign later so dont be in a hurry to sign the form. CHECK and Double Check. Then they get your signature, LEFT thumbprint and RIGHT thumb print. The process is really quick and easy. After double checking everything, I signed the form and returned it to the window 7.

IMPORTANT TIPS:
1. Dont go to DFA unprepared. GOOGLE for info or ask from your friends. I asked the people next to me in the pila but all of them are first timers. I didnt get useful info.
2. Always prepare small bills and loose change for payments, xerox and transpo.
3. BRING BALLPEN and all your documents. I have a folder that contains important documents just incase its needed. XEROX required documents
4. Bring food, water and books to read. Know where the CR is.
